Digital Core Program (4 of 13) Response
Program Title Dragonfly TV (1/25-3/29/15)
Origination Syndicated
Days/Times Program Regularly Scheduled Sunday, 11:30AM
Total times aired at regularly scheduled time 10
Total times aired
Number of Preemptions 0
Number of Preemptions for other than Breaking News
Number of Preemptions Rescheduled
Length of Program 30 mins
Age of Target Child Audience 13 years to 16 years
Describe the educational and informational objective of the program and how it meets the definition of Core Programming. This program features children engaging in various science projects and demonstrates practical applications of mathematics and science from multiple scientific fields. It introduces young viewers to a variety of scientific disciplines and challenges them in critical thinking and problem solving skills, while providing valuable information to reach answers. Examples of program episodes include studying various ecosystems, sea turtles, and rocket propulsion. Each episode is engaging, entertaining and educational in structure, allowing children to gain an appreciation for science in a unique and entertaining way. This program aired on the secondary digital stream, WPEC-DT2 (Weather Nation)

Digital Core Program (7 of 13) Response
Program Title Henry Ford's Innovation Nation (1/3-3/28/15)
Origination Network
Days/Times Program Regularly Scheduled Saturdays, 10AM
Total times aired at regularly scheduled time 13
Total times aired
Number of Preemptions 0
Number of Preemptions for other than Breaking News
Number of Preemptions Rescheduled
Length of Program 30 mins
Age of Target Child Audience 13 years to 16 years
Describe the educational and informational objective of the program and how it meets the definition of Core Programming. HENRY FORD'S INNOVATION NATION - hosted by Mo Rocca, this program is a weekly celebration of the inventor's spirit; from historic scientific pioneers throughout past centuries to the forward-looking visionaries of today. Each episode inspires young viewers to dream, create and innovate by telling the dramatic stories behind the world's greatest inventions and the perseverance, passion and price required to bring them to life. Episodes examples include innovators who have condensed a TV satellite truck into a backpack, how solar roads could power the world, and a 16- year-old who invented a battery-free flashlight. This program aired on the main digital stream, WPEC-DT in high definition.

See 47 C.F.R. Section 73.671, NOTES 2 and 3. Note: WPEC ceased airing programming on stream D3 as of January 19, 2015 and began airing programming on stream D2 as of January 20, 2015. WPEC has a weekly franchise called "Forever Family" which airs every Tuesday in the 5:00PM newscast. "Forever Family" are news stories about children in foster care. We also have an annual "Health & Wellness Expo" which services the community. Tours of the station are regularly given to children's groups.
